Researchers have developed a new framework for abstractive summarization that decouples the generation and selection processes to improve factual consistency and control summary length. This modular approach uses a pretrained generator to create multiple candidate summaries, which are then evaluated and selected by a combinatorial process. Experiments on various datasets, including CNN/DailyMail and Multi-News, demonstrated consistent improvements in factuality and source-grounding metrics, with human evaluations indicating higher perceived quality.
